8 Peter Eberhardt Fernwood Consulting Group Inc Efficiencies with Large Datasets Making Your Dataset S m a l l e r SAS COMPRESS option – COMPRESS=YES Compresses character variables – COMPRESS=BINARY Compresses numeric variables – POINTOBS=YES Allows the use of POINT= in compressed data May increase CPU in creating the dataset

9 Peter Eberhardt Fernwood Consulting Group Inc Efficiencies with Large Datasets Making Your Dataset S m a l l e r LENGTH statement – SAS numbers stored as 8 bytes Careful about loss of data – Character fields stored as length of their first reference

11 Peter Eberhardt Fernwood Consulting Group Inc Efficiencies with Large Datasets Making Your Dataset S m a l l e r LENGTH statement – Affects the way numbers are stored in the dataset. In memory all numbers are expanded to 8 bytes

12 Peter Eberhardt Fernwood Consulting Group Inc Efficiencies with Large Datasets Making Your Dataset S m a l l e r LENGTH character variables data charvars; infile inpFile; input code $1. ……; if code = ‘A’ then acctType = ‘Active’; else if code = ‘I’ then acctType = ‘In Active’; else if code = ‘C’ then acctType = ‘Closed’; else acctType = ‘Unknown; run;

13 Peter Eberhardt Fernwood Consulting Group Inc Efficiencies with Large Datasets Making Your Dataset S m a l l e r LENGTH character variables data charvars; infile inpFile; input code $1. ……; if code = ‘I’ then acctType = ‘In Active’; else if code = ‘A’ then acctType = ‘Active’; else if code = ‘C’ then acctType = ‘Closed’; else acctType = ‘Unknown; run;

14 Peter Eberhardt Fernwood Consulting Group Inc Efficiencies with Large Datasets Making Your Dataset S m a l l e r LENGTH character variables data charvars; infile inpFile; length accType $9; input code $1. ……; if code = ‘A’ then acctType = ‘Active’; else if code = ‘I’ then acctType = ‘In Active’; else if code = ‘C’ then acctType = ‘Closed’; else acctType = ‘Unknown; run;

17 Peter Eberhardt Fernwood Consulting Group Inc Efficiencies with Large Datasets Making Your Dataset S m a l l e r KEEP/DROP – Limits the columns read/saved – Dataset option set gasug.large (keep=r1 r2) Can be used in PROCs (including SQL) – Data step statement keep r1 r2

18 Peter Eberhardt Fernwood Consulting Group Inc Efficiencies with Large Datasets Making Your Dataset S m a l l e r TESTING – Sampling RANUNI() – Uniform random distribution between 0 and 1 – Approximate number of records – OBS= Limits number of records – Exact number of records

20 Peter Eberhardt Fernwood Consulting Group Inc Efficiencies with Large Datasets Sorting SORT options – NOEQUALS – SORTSIZE= Be careful with SORTSIZE=MAX – TAGSORT – Indexing Data Step SQL – Don’t sort Sortedby dataset option
